The registration process includes the Following steps:
-
>>
1. PRELIMINARY SEARCH (OPTIONAL)
A trade mark search may be conducted prior to application for registration of the trade mark. The search is important to ensure that no identical trademark has been registered or is pending registration.
-
>>
2. APPLICATION FOR TRADE MARK REGISTRARTION
Trade Mark Form No. 2 is used for the application of Trade Mark. An Applicant is required to attached four (4) representations of the trade mark with a prescribed fee of $ 200.00 or its Cedi equivalent. Applicants whose principal place of business is located outside Ghana are required to apply through legal entity.
-
>>
3. REVIEW/EXAMINATION OF TM. No 2 BY THE TRADE MARKS OFFICE.
The Registrar examines whether the Trade Mark application is in conformity with the requirements of.
• Section 1, Section 3, Subsection (1) and (2) of Section 4, and Section 5 of the Trade Marks Act, 2004, Act 664
-
>>
4. PUBLICATION AND OPPOSITION OF TRADEMARK
All Trade Mark application accepted by the Registrar are published in the Industrial Trade Marks Bulletin (Journal) for a period of two (2) months. Within this period any interested party/person may file for a notice of opposition to the registration in a prescribed manner.
-
>>
5. CERTIFICATION OF TRADEMARK
In the event where there are no Opposition to the approved Trademarks, the proprietor of a Trademark requests for the issuance of his trade mark certificate. A certificate of Registration of Trade Mark is then issued to the applicant and the registered trademark is valid for a period of 10 years from the filing date of the application.
-
>>
6. RENEWAL OF TRADE MARKS
Renewal of trademarks are made every ten (10) years.
-
>>
NB: Non-use for 5 years following registration makes the registration vulnerable to cancellation.

SCHEDULE OF TRADE MARK FEES
TRADE MARK SEARCH : $ 110.00
TRADE MARK APPLICATON : $ 200.00
CERTIFICATION OF TRADE MARK : $ 200.00
